Things to do in Ziracuaretiro
1. Explore the Monastery of San Juan Parangaricutiro
Visit this historic monastery known for its beautiful architecture and tranquil atmosphere. Learn about the local history and culture as you wander through the corridors and gardens.
2. Hike to Paricutin Volcano
Embark on a thrilling hike to the Paricutin Volcano, one of the Seven Natural Wonders of the World. Marvel at the volcanic landscape and take in panoramic views from the summit.
3. Shop at the Ziracuaretiro Market
Discover unique handicrafts, souvenirs, and locally made products at the vibrant Ziracuaretiro Market. Immerse yourself in the bustling atmosphere and pick up some authentic treasures.
4. Taste Traditional Purépecha Cuisine
Indulge in delicious traditional Purépecha dishes at local restaurants and eateries. Try specialties like corundas, uchepos, and atole, and savor the authentic flavors of the region.
